The Consequences of DUI: How to Get a Revoked License Reinstated

The Consequences of DUI: How to Get a Revoked License Reinstated

Illinois takes DUIs very seriously. In 2009, it doubled the penalties for first-time offenders. If the police arrest you for a DUI, you can see your license suspended automatically for six months. After a DUI conviction, the minimum license revocation is a full year. Those on their second or third convictions lose their ability to […]
